Cute Kitty Day Look
In this Hello Kitty Day Look Jigsaw puzzle game you have 6 images with famous character Hello Kitty dressed in different clothes, created in three modes to play. Choose one of the mode for the game that you previous choose and start to play. Drag and drop the pieces to solve the puzzle. Enjoy, and have fun!
Game Instructions: Cute Kitty Day Look
Use mouse to play this game.
